The invention provides an aircraft anti-skid brake system fault processing method which is applied to an aircraft anti-skid brake system, and the aircraft anti-skid brake system comprises a brake instruction sensor (1), an anti-skid brake controller (2), a brake cut-off valve (3), an anti-skid brake control valve (4), an aircraft wheel speed sensor (5) and a brake pressure sensor (6). The method comprises the steps that the anti-skid brake system obtains the airplane speed V and the airplane wheel speed V in real time; according to the airplane speed V (km / h) and the airplane wheel speed V (km / h), the airplane wheel slip amount eta of the current airplane wheel is calculated according to a formula, and eta belongs to [0, 1]; the slipping amount eta of the airplane wheel is judged; when eta<M1, it is determined that the airplane wheel is in a normal slipping state; when M1<=eta<M2, it is determined that the airplane wheel is in a moderate slipping state; when eta>=M2, it is determined that the airplane wheel is in a severe slipping state; and a corresponding fault processing strategy is adopted according to the slipping state of the airplane wheel.

[0001] The invention relates to the technical field of an aircraft anti-skid brake control system, in particular to a method for troubleshooting an aircraft anti-skid brake system. Background technique

[0002] The aircraft braking system is a subsystem with relatively independent functions on the aircraft. Its function is to bear the static weight and dynamic impact load of the aircraft and absorb the kinetic energy of the aircraft when it lands, so as to realize the braking and control of the aircraft's take-off, landing, and taxiing. At present, aircraft braking systems are widely equipped with anti-skid control functions to ensure that the aircraft will not brake tires during the braking process, prevent aircraft brakes from blowing out, and improve the safety of aircraft braking and deceleration.
